x402 MCP Server
An MCP (Model Context Protocol) server that exposes x402 DeFi data endpoints as tools for AI agents.
What is MCP?
MCP is an open standard that lets AI applications (Claude, Cursor, OpenClaw, etc.) discover and use tools through a unified protocol. Think of it as a USB-C port for AI — any compliant client can plug into any compliant server.
This server wraps the x402 API (pay-per-call DeFi data) so that any MCP-compatible AI agent can:
- Discover available data endpoints
- Call them with proper parameters
- Get structured results back
Tools
| Tool | Description |
|---|---|
get_crypto_prices |
Current prices, 24h changes, top movers |
analyze_whale_concentration |
Token holder concentration & whale risk (param: token) |
compare_funding_rates |
Perp funding rates across exchanges + arb opportunities |
list_available_endpoints |
Discover all available x402 API endpoints |
Prerequisites
- The x402 API server must be running at
localhost:4020(or setX402_API_URL) - Node.js 18+
Setup
cd x402-mcp-server
npm install
Connect to Claude Desktop
Add to ~/Library/Application Support/Claude/claude_desktop_config.json:
{
"mcpServers": {
"x402-defi": {
"command": "node",
"args": ["/absolute/path/to/x402-mcp-server/src/index.js"],
"env": {
"X402_API_URL": "http://localhost:4020"
}
}
}
}
Connect to Cursor
Add to .cursor/mcp.json in your project (or global settings):
{
"mcpServers": {
"x402-defi": {
"command": "node",
"args": ["/absolute/path/to/x402-mcp-server/src/index.js"]
}
}
}
Connect to OpenClaw
openclaw mcp add x402-defi -- node /absolute/path/to/x402-mcp-server/src/index.js
Test Locally
# Start the x402 API server first
cd ../x402-api-server && npm start &
# Test MCP server with the MCP inspector
npx @modelcontextprotocol/inspector node src/index.js
# Or pipe JSON-RPC manually:
echo '{"jsonrpc":"2.0","id":1,"method":"initialize","params":{"protocolVersion":"2024-11-05","capabilities":{},"clientInfo":{"name":"test","version":"1.0.0"}}}' | node src/index.js
Architecture
AI Agent (Claude/Cursor/OpenClaw)
↕ MCP (stdio, JSON-RPC)
x402 MCP Server (this)
↕ HTTP
x402 API Server (localhost:4020)
↕ x402 protocol (HTTP 402 + USDC)
DeFi Data Sources
